Acceptance Rate and Application Statistics

The following table compares the admission related statistics including number of applicants, admitted, and enrolled between selected colleges. The average acceptance rate of selected colleges is 75.13% and the average admission yield (enrollment rate) is 31.69%.
Tennessee Wesleyan University has the tighest (lowest) acceptance rate of 60.74% and The University of Tennessee Southern has the highest yield (enrollment rate) of 42.83% among selected colleges. The numbers in parenthesis() in below table represent the number and rate by gender (men/women). The stat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023.
Admission Stats Comparison Between Selected Colleges
Name ApplicantsAdmittedEnrolledAcceptance RateEnrollment Rate
Aquinas College no recent data available (probably not active)
Christian Brothers University 877 (408/465) 767 (369/397) 175 (89/86) 87% (90%/85%) 23% (24%/18%)
The University of Tennessee Southern 608 (194/414) 488 (145/343) 209 (64/145) 80% (75%/83%) 43% (44%/35%)
Tennessee Wesleyan University 968 (351/617) 588 (198/390) 200 (86/114) 61% (56%/63%) 34% (43%/18%)
